Married At First Sight’s Stephanie Marshall celebrates birthday with new beau in Brisbane… as Tyson Gordon reveals why their relationship failed
She failed to forge a connection with her Married At First Sight groom Tyson Gordon, but Stephanie Marshall is certainly not wallowing in heartbreak.
The reality star celebrated her 33rd birthday in Brisbane this week with a brand new beau, Aaron, on her arm.
The newly minted couple were not afraid to flaunt their burgeoning love either, pausing for a kiss as they made their way to a nearby restaurant for a romantic lunch date.
Stephanie was positively glowing as she walked, beaming as she held Aaron’s hand tightly in hers.
Aaron, too, looked chuffed to be in Stephanie’s company, grinning broadly as he escorted her to the restaurant.
Stephanie also cut quite the chic figure, stepping out in a sleeveless, electric blue halter dress that clung perfectly to her svelte frame.

The dress also boasted chunky gold buttons down the front, and a cheeky knee-high split that flaunted the MAFS star’s lithe legs.
Wearing her flaxen locks tied back for the romantic rendezvous, Stephanie finished her look with a pair of strappy gold heels.
Dialing back on the bling for the outing, Stephanie accessorised with a cute tan-coloured Saint Laurent clutch.
Aaron, meanwhile, wore a light blue collared shirt and a pair of light grey chinos.
Sporting facial hair on his top lip, he brought the outfit together with a brown leather belt and a pair of matching boots.
Speaking to Daily Mail, Stephanie revealed that the pair began dating in late October, after finalising a real estate deal.
‘I sold him a house when I was in the experiment and then, after I left, we did the pre-settlement inspection and met there and have been dating ever since,’ she said.
She admitted that sparks ignited almost immediately with Aaron, saying that she was attracted to her new beau’s ‘thoughtful nature’ and ’emotional maturity’.

Drawing a clear distinction between Aaron and Tyson, Stephanie didn’t mince words when discussing her ex, saying he behaved like ‘a big kid’ and insisting the pair are ‘completely different people.’
Meanwhile, Tyson also revealed to Daily Mail that there was never any spark with Stephanie, describing their short-lived marriage as more of a friendship.
‘Steph – I think she’s a great person,’ Tyson said.
‘I’ve got nothing really bad to say about Steph, quite frankly… but just the connection wasn’t there and yeah, it just wasn’t meant to be.’
He added that he knew that it wasn’t meant to be as soon as he first laid eyes on Stephanie at their wedding.
‘I just didn’t feel the connection. I just didn’t feel the spark,’ he said.
‘As soon as I saw her walk down the aisle… I thought she was pretty, don’t get me wrong, but just I don’t know… I really didn’t feel, I didn’t have any feelings there.’
Adding that the couple’s off-camera life was nowhere near as dramatic as what viewers saw, Tyson said he ‘pulled back’ from his bride as he didn’t want to waste her time.

‘There’s no point sticking around with someone that you don’t see a future with,’ he said.
‘The worst thing you can do is lead someone on.’
While admitting that Stephanie was a ‘great person’ Tyson said he felt let down by his bride in the experiment.
‘I feel like she didn’t have my back. She was supposed to be this conservative woman, but she didn’t really have my back in any of my conservative views,’ he said.
‘I think our personalities collided a little bit. I think maybe the attraction as well wasn’t there for both of us.’
